Nintendo Unveils the Next-Gen Switch 2 Gaming Console
2025-04-02

In a highly anticipated announcement, Nintendo has officially revealed its next-generation gaming console, the Nintendo Switch 2. Set to launch in the US on June 5, 2025, with pre-orders opening on April 9, this new device promises significant upgrades over its predecessor. Featuring a larger 7.9-inch 1080p LCD screen with a 120Hz refresh rate and the ability to output 4K/60fps through an advanced docking station, the Switch 2 aims to redefine portable gaming. The console will come equipped with 256GB of internal storage and support for microSD Express cards, ensuring ample space for games and media. Alongside the hardware enhancements, several exclusive titles such as Donkey Kong Bananza, The Duskbloods, and Kirby AirRiders are set to captivate gamers worldwide.

Revolutionary Upgrades and Exclusive Titles

In the vibrant world of gaming technology, Nintendo has once again made waves with the unveiling of the Nintendo Switch 2. This remarkable piece of tech is scheduled to hit the market in the United States on June 5, 2025. Pre-order opportunities will begin on April 9, giving eager fans plenty of time to secure their units. At the heart of the Switch 2 lies a stunning 7.9-inch LCD display boasting a resolution of 1080p and a rapid 120Hz refresh rate. When connected to its cutting-edge dock, players can enjoy crisp 4K visuals at a smooth 60 frames per second, offering an unparalleled gaming experience.

Beyond visual advancements, the Switch 2 includes a generous 256GB of internal storage, which marks a substantial leap from the original model's modest 32GB. However, users must now utilize microSD Express cards, as older formats are no longer compatible. Enhanced Joy-Con controllers introduce magnetic attachments and improved gyroscopes, promising greater precision during gameplay. Notably, these controllers can function as mice, adding versatility to select titles like Drag X Drive and Civilization VII.

Further enhancing multiplayer experiences, Nintendo has integrated a Discord-like GameChat feature, enabling seamless communication between friends. A USB-C camera accessory further enriches social interactions by incorporating video feeds into online sessions. Among the numerous launch titles, standout exclusives include Donkey Kong Bananza and The Duskbloods, developed by FromSoftware, alongside eagerly awaited third-party contributions such as Elden Ring and Cyberpunk 2077.

Pricing Details: The base model of the Nintendo Switch 2 retails at $449.99, while a bundle including Mario Kart World costs $499.99. Purchased separately, Mario Kart World is priced at $79.99.

In addition to the console itself, Nintendo Switch Online subscribers will gain access to classic GameCube games, complete with enhanced resolutions and multiplayer options.

The Switch 2 also supports upgrade packs for existing Switch games, introducing optimized graphics and features tailored specifically for the new platform.
